Improved Conditions but Pace was brutal
Greens were in really good shape after being aerated. A few questionable spots but overall really good. Bunkers were vastly improved. Fairways were still fine although very brown. A couple of tees were tough to get the leg in, but overall course conditions. With lack of rain, we’re very good. Pace of place was awful. 4.75 hrs to play at 7:30 am was ludicrous. Number 1 issue at Hernando is pace of play. Ranger needs to ensure faster pace.

Good Layout & Greens
Not much has changed at Hernando since I played it last winter, although I must say the greens were quite acceptable and fully grassed. The layout is quite good but it’s just unfortunate they don’t have sufficient funds to maintain it any better than they do. It needs more water and fertilizer to green it up, as well as a bunker maintenance program, including more sand in them.
The sidelines around greens and fairways are thin, so offline shots regularly roll off into thin lies or the woods.
All in all, it’s a good track, worth playing to see for yourself. Playing it regularly however would wear on me.
